You have been asked to flip a coin for heads or tails and then select a golf ball from a bucket that contains 2 yellow golf ball

s and 5 white golf balls. List the possible outcomes in the sample space. What is the probability you get tails and select a white golf​ ball?
Use Y and a number to represent a yellow golf ball and W and a number to represent a white golf ball. Which list below shows the sample​ space?
A.
​{HW1, HW2,​ HY1, HY2,​ HY3, HY4,​ HY5, TW1,​ TW2, TY1,​ TY2, TY3,​ TY4, TY5}
B.
​{HY1, HY2,​ HW1, HW2,​ HW3, HW4,​ HW5, TY1,​ TY2, TW1,​ TW2, TW3,​ TW4, TW5}
C.
​{HY, HW,​ TY, TW}

Answer:

​{HY1, HY2,​ HW1, HW2,​ HW3, HW4,​ HW5, TY1,​ TY2, TW1,​ TW2, TW3,​ TW4, TW5}

The probability you get tails and select a white golf​ ball is 0.36

Step-by-step explanation:

There are 2 yellow golf balls: Y1 and Y2

There are 5 white golf balls: W1, W2, W3, W4 and W5

Then, the sample space is: ​{HY1, HY2,​ HW1, HW2,​ HW3, HW4,​ HW5, TY1,​ TY2, TW1,​ TW2, TW3,​ TW4, TW5}

What is the probability you get tails and select a white golf​ ball?

desired outcomes {TW1,​ TW2, TW3,​ TW4, TW5}

number of desired outcomes: 5

number of possible outcomes: 14

probability: 5/14 = 0.36
